What is the seat reservation policy of SSBF?
0 Follower
10 Views
Arshita TiwariCurrent Student
Contributor-Level 9
In every programme, 15% of the seats are reserved for SC and international students, each. ST and PwD category students have a seat reservation of 7.5% and 3%, respectively.

What is the application fee for SSBF?
0 Follower
2 Views
Arshita TiwariCurrent Student
Contributor-Level 9
SSBF application fee is Rs 1,000. Candidates can pay the fee online via debit/ credit cards or net banking.

The highest package offered to 2023 batch students of SSBF was INR 19.59 LPA, whereas for SIBM Hyderabad the highest package stood at INR 15 LPA. The table below compares the 2023 placement statistics of SSBF Pune and SIBM Hyderabad:Institute Namethe highest Package (2023)Average Package (2023)SSBFINR 19.59 LPAINR 10.56 LPASIBM HyderabadINR 15 LPAINR 8.90 LPA

How were summer internships at SSBF Pune?

The institute has successfully interned 100% of the eligible students of batch 2023-25. The highest stipend offered was INR 75,000 per month. Companies like the Kaima Assets, Ventura Securities, Allied Analytics, Axis Bank, among others participated in the summer internship programme and offered job roles in various domains. The key highlights of SSBF summer internships 2023-25 are tabulated below:ParticularsStatistics (2023-25)Placement rate100%Highest stipendINR 75,000 per monthAverage stipendINR 21,000 per monthTop profile Equity ResearchPopular recruitersJP Morgan Chase & Co., CRISIL, RXIL
